Firstbuy is a Government purchase assistance scheme for first time buyers and those who require some financial assistance to buy a new home and is expected to assist around 10,500 buyers onto the property ladder over the next two years.

If you qualify for the Firstbuy scheme you will have the opportunity to select one of the Firstbuy properties available from Miller Homes of which you will own 100% of the property but only fund as little as 80% of the value now, with both Miller Homes and the Government equally funding the remaining 20% in the form of an equity loan.
